What Yoodli does well

Yoodli is genuinely good at what it does. The delivery analytics are clean, the enterprise roleplay programs are polished, and if your employer provides Yoodli, using it is a no-brainer. For pure public-speaking coaching — pacing, filler words, presentation practice — it is one of the best consumer tools available (as of July 2026).

Where AISIM is different

AISIM does two things Yoodli does not focus on. First, the personas are adversarial by design: the Nightmare-mode difficulty setting produces a skeptical interviewer who interrupts rambles and demands specifics, not a patient listener. Second, the report grades substance — it quotes what you actually said and shows a better line for each moment — alongside the delivery metrics you would expect. It also covers life scenarios beyond speeches: negotiations, visa windows, hard 1:1s, and client pitches.

Frequently asked

Does AISIM measure filler words and pace like Yoodli?

Yes. Every Sim Report includes delivery metrics — filler-word count, words per minute, and talk-ratio — alongside a substance score.

What does 'grading substance' actually mean?

The report quotes your exact words at the moments that mattered — an answer you fumbled, a claim you left vague, a number you promised without backing — and shows a specific better line for each.

Is Yoodli still consumer-friendly?

Yoodli remains available to consumers at the time of writing (July 2026), though its investment and roadmap have leaned increasingly toward enterprise and L&D buyers. Its pricing page lists consumer plans starting at approximately $8–20/month with a limited free tier.

Can I use AISIM for a presentation, not an interview?

Yes, though AISIM shines when there is another voice in the room pushing back. For pure solo presentation coaching Yoodli may fit better; for pitches, panels, and interviews AISIM is stronger.

How harsh is Nightmare mode?

Skeptical from minute one, interrupts rambles past forty seconds, demands specific numbers, drops one deliberate long silence, and returns to your weakest answer. Never insults you personally — pressure is aimed at answers.
